AT&T Universal Card Late Fee When No Bill Was Received

I had been a credit card holder with AT&T Univeral Card for probably a decade and always paid my bills in full prior to the due date. I didn't get a bill in December 2004, but knew that I had charged on the card. Knowing my bill was due near the ned of the month, I went on line on December 24, 2004, learned my bill was due on December 20, 2004, and paid the charges in full.

 

I checked my account on January 6, 2005, and learned that I was charged a $29.00 late fee. I contacted the company, but only received a canned response back. I closed the account the same night. Until AT&T was purchased by Citbank I never had any problems with the account. As soon as Citbank took over, problems began.

 

Now I know why Citbank is so large. Card holders beware. Write on your calendar when payment is due on this card, because even if you don't recieve a bill, you're responsible for a lete fee. I paid a $29.00 fee on a statement that was paid in full. If this happens to you, don't waste your time trying to contact the company. My best advice is to close out this card if you have it and find a company that will respond to your questions.
